About This Item

New York: Charles Scribner's Sons, 1899. Special Edition. Hardcover. Book condition is Very Good in marbled boards, bound in 3/4 leather with a hubbed spine, marbled end papers and gilt top page edges. A few small bumps and nicks to spine. Wear to leather at spine edges. Text is clean and unmarked. Frontispiece portrait of Mr. Stevenson. ; 8vo 8" - 9" tall.
